Best time to go to Pyecombe

The best time to visit Pyecombe can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Pyecombe fal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Pyecombe fal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ly Low
March45.1°F (7.3°C)No R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ly Low
April48.6°F (9.2°C)No R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
May53.4°F (11.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June58.8°F (14.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July62.6°F (17.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
August63.0°F (17.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September60.3°F (15.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November49.5°F (9.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age

What is the best area to stay in Pyecombe?
Pyecombe is a small village, so the best area to stay is generally within the village itself, particularly around the church and the main road, London Road.

The village centre is quite compact, with the historic St. Mary's Church as a key landmark. London Road runs through the heart of Pyecombe, offering easy access to the surrounding South Downs National Park. Accommodation here typically consists of guesthouses or a country inn, providing a quiet and relaxed setting.

Couples looking for a peaceful escape will find Pyecombe ideal. The village offers immediate access to walking trails across the South Downs, great for scenic strolls and enjoying the English countryside. You're also well-placed for visiting nearby attractions like the Jack and Jill Windmills, which are just a short drive away.

For travellers planning to explore the wider Sussex area by car, staying in Pyecombe offers excellent convenience.
When is the best time to go to Pyecombe?
The best time to visit Pyecombe is during the late spring and summer months, from May to September, when the weather is generally mild and pleasant.

During this period, you'll experience longer daylight hours, making it ideal for exploring the South Downs National Park and enjoying outdoor activities. The average temperatures range from 15°C to 22°C (59°F to 72°F), great for walking, cycling, or visiting local attractions without the chill of winter.

For those who enjoy a quieter experience, May and September offer comfortable weather with fewer crowds. This allows for a more relaxed exploration of the footpaths and bridleways, and you'll find it easier to secure reservations at local eateries.

Families travelling with children will find July and August particularly appealing, as the warmer temperatures are great for outdoor adventures, and local events often take place during the school holidays.
